Understanding Bitcoin Live Trackers
A Bitcoin Live Tracker, often referred to simply as a "tracker," is an application or service designed to display the current value of Bitcoin in real-time against various global currencies. These trackers not only show the base price but also provide detailed analytics such as market trends, trading volumes, and news updates that significantly influence the cryptocurrency's price fluctuation.
How Does It Work?
The operation of a Bitcoin Live Tracker is primarily based on data feeds derived from various sources including cryptocurrency exchanges, APIs (Application Programming Interfaces), blockchain analysis, and user inputs. These trackers aggregate this information in real-time to provide the most accurate and up-to-date price and market status for Bitcoin.
Types of Live Tracker Features:
1. Price Tracking: The primary function of a tracker is to show the current Bitcoin value against multiple currencies, like USD, EUR, or GBP. This feature allows users to understand how their holdings are performing in real-time.
2. Trading Volumes: By tracking the volumes of trades completed, trackers offer insights into market activity and liquidity. High trading volume often indicates a healthy market while low volumes may suggest less interest or volatility.
3. Market Cap: Market cap (market capitalization) is another significant indicator that live trackers display. It represents the total value of all outstanding Bitcoin units, giving users an overview of its overall worth in the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
4. Trend Analysis: Many Bitcoin Live Trackers offer charting options to help traders and investors visualize price trends over different time periods. This feature is crucial for identifying patterns that could signal future market movements.
5. News Updates: Real-time news alerts are a critical component of live trackers, as they can rapidly influence the cryptocurrency's value. These updates cover everything from regulatory developments to technological advancements in the blockchain technology underpinning Bitcoin.

Limitations and Considerations
While Bitcoin Live Trackers offer numerous benefits, they are not without their limitations:
1. Data Reliability: The accuracy of live tracking data depends on the reliability of its sources. Users must ensure they trust the tracker's information to avoid misinformed decisions.
2. Accessibility: Not all users may have access to real-time trackers, especially those without a strong internet connection or those using less advanced devices.
3. Subscription Costs: Some premium Bitcoin Live Trackers require subscriptions, which can be financially burdensome for casual users.
4. Manipulation Concerns: There is a risk that the information displayed by trackers could be manipulated or hacked into, affecting their reliability. Users must ensure they are using reputable sources.
